一 删除数据
Delete
DELETE FROM tbl_name [WHERE where_definition] [ORDER BY ...] [LIMIT row_count]按照条件删除 指定删除的最多记录数。Limit 可以通过排序条件删除。Order by + limit 支持多表删除,使用类似连接语法。 Delete f
转载
2024-08-22 17:08:47
66阅读
# MySQL 删除物化视图对应用的影响
在现代数据库管理中,物化视图(Materialized View)是一种重要的数据结构,可以显著提升查询性能。随着系统的不断演进和需求的变化,删除不再使用的物化视图是一项必要的维护工作。今天我们就来讨论如何通过 MySQL 删除物化视图,以及这一步骤对应用的影响。
## 流程概述
下面的流程表展示了删除物化视图的主要步骤:
| 步骤编号 | 步骤描
## MySQL 删除表或视图 SQL
在日常的数据库管理中,经常需要删除数据库中的表或视图。MySQL提供了相应的SQL语句来完成这个任务。本文将向您介绍如何使用MySQL删除表或视图的SQL语句,并提供一些示例代码。
### 删除表
要删除MySQL数据库中的表,您可以使用`DROP TABLE`语句。下面是删除表的基本语法:
```sql
DROP TABLE table_name;
原创
2023-10-12 06:49:29
226阅读
视图所依赖的表被删除后 对该视图的影响
原创
2022-08-04 20:49:32
263阅读
# MySQL中通过视图更新基本表
在MySQL中,视图是一种虚拟表,它是从一个或多个基本表中导出的。视图的主要优点在于提供了一个简化的界面,可以通过这个界面来查询和管理数据,而不必直接操作基础数据表。此外,通过视图更新基本表也是一个相对常见的操作,本文将详细介绍如何在MySQL中通过视图更新基本表,包括流程和示例代码。
## 什么是视图?
视图是一个存储的查询,它可以像表一样使用。创建一个
原创
2024-08-29 05:13:24
197阅读
一个或者多个数据表里的数据的逻辑显示,视图并不存储数据视图的作用可以屏蔽一些敏感字段,比如员工薪资如果是一些大型的表,不同的用户所需要的字段不一样,可以给不同的用户定制不同的查询视图视图的优点操作简单,和操作表很像减少数据冗余,因为视图本身不存储数据数据安全,将用户能访问的数据限制在特定的数据集上修改方便,适合灵活多变的需求视图的理解视图时一种虚拟表,本身是不存储数据的,占用很少的空间视图建立在已
转载
2024-04-25 12:48:02
226阅读
一、视图概述:(1)什么是视图?视图是基于 SQL 语句的结果集的可视化的表。视图包含行和列,就像一个真实的表。视图中的字段就是来自一个或多个数据库中的真实的表中的字段。视图并不在数据库中以存储的数据值集形式存在,而是存在于实际引用的数据库表中,视图的构成可以是单表查询,多表联合查询,分组查询以及计算(表达式)查询等。行和列数据来自由定义视图的查询所引用的表,并且在引用视图时动态生成。(2)视图的
转载
2023-09-29 10:05:19
93阅读
视图是一种虚拟存在的表,对于使用视图的用户来说基本上是透明的。视图并不在数据库中实际存在,行和列数据来自定义视图的查询总使用的表,并且是在使用视图时动态生成的。 视图相对于普通表的优势:简单:使用视图的用户完全不需要关系后面对应的表结构、关联条件和筛选条件,对用户来说已经是过滤好的符合条件的结果集。安全:使用视图的用户只能访问他们被允许的结果集,对表的权限管理并不
转载
2023-10-26 18:47:09
66阅读
什么是视图视图是从一个或多个表中导出来的表,是一种虚拟存在的表。视图就像一个窗口,通过这个窗口可以看到系统专门提供的数据。这样,用户可以不用看到整个数据库中的数据,而之关心对自己有用的数据。数据库中只存放了视图的定义,而没有存放视图中的数据,这些数据存放在原来的表中。使用视图查询数据时,数据库系统会从原来的表中取出对应的数据。视图中的数据依赖于原来表中的数据,一旦表中数据发生改变,显示在视图中的数
转载
2023-08-07 16:12:41
115阅读
/*视图*/--视图不占用物理空间
/*表和视图共享数据库中相同的名称空间,因此,数据库不能包含具有相同名称的表和视图*/
/*视图缩减业务逻辑 http://blog.itpub.net/28194062/viewspace-772902/
视图用来隐藏复杂的业务逻辑,从join连接查询产生一个view。先使用 视图完成一定的逻辑,再在视图的基础上完成另外的逻辑。
通常,视图完成的逻辑都是相对比
转载
2023-08-20 15:36:29
0阅读
视图概述 视图View是一种虚拟存在的表.行和列数据来自自定义视图的查询中使用的表,在使用视图时动态生成. 视图的优势: 简单:用户不需要关心后面对应的表的结构,关联条件和筛选条件.对用户来说事已经过滤筛选好的复合
转载
2024-07-25 15:02:41
26阅读
一张虚表,和真实的表一样。视图包含一系列带有名称的行和列数据。视图是从一个或多个表中导出来的,我 们可以通过insert,update,delete来操作视图。当通过视图看到的数据被修改时,相应的原表的数据也会变 化。同时原表发生变化,则这种变化也可以自动反映到视图中。视图的优点1. 简单化:看到的就是需要的。视图不仅可以简化用户对数据的理解,也可以简化操作。经常被使用的查 询可以制作成一个视图2
转载
2023-08-07 14:25:24
501阅读
为什么使用视图? 既然视图存在那就有它存在的必要。换言之,它有优点。优点:重用SQL语句简化复杂的SQL操作。编写查询后,可以方便地重用它而不必知道它而不必知道它的基本查询细节。使用表地组成部分而不是整个表保护数据。可以给用户授予表的特定部分的访问权限而不是整个表的访问权限更改数据格式和表示。视图可返还与底层表的表示和格式不同的数据有优点就有缺点缺点:视图不能索引,触发器,
转载
2023-06-01 19:43:46
985阅读
对于一张专门用于存储数据的表来说,数据量通常会很大。项目中总会有一些表数据量非常大,并且在使用过程中,需要频繁地到这些表中查询数据。数据量大的时候,查询速度会明显变慢,这时候就需要对查询速度进行优化了。优化的方式很多,一个比较简单且低成本的方式就是创建索引。一、索引简介索引的目的是为了提高数据表的查询效率。索引的作用类似于字典前面的拼音,笔画。拼音的顺序是固定的,在不知道一个字怎么写时,可以快速根
# MySQL删除视图
在MySQL数据库中,视图是一种虚拟的表,它是由一个查询语句定义的。使用视图,可以将复杂的查询封装在一个对象中,使得查询更加方便和简洁。然而,有时候我们可能需要删除已经创建的视图。本文将介绍如何在MySQL中删除视图,并提供相应的代码示例。
## 删除视图的语法
在MySQL中,删除视图的语法如下:
```sql
DROP VIEW [IF EXISTS] view
原创
2023-09-02 06:57:01
728阅读
视图先来说说啥是视图,我们继续百度百科通过阅读这一段话,我们可以知道,视图就是指的数据库中的一个虚拟表,也就是说真实情况下不存在的。而且这个表就只用来查看,增删改还去去具体表。再有就是后面的,视图并不在数据库中以存储的数据值集形式存在,而这句话正好证实了我前面一句,增删改还得去具体表,视图里面是不存着数据的。视图的作用和好坏处大概知道这么多,我们再来说一下这个东西有啥作用和好处。作用其实就是为了展
转载
2023-09-04 20:41:17
194阅读
创建,删除数据库 指定字符集create database 数据库名[default character set utf8]; (~的点 为引号)drop database 数据库名;&nbs
转载
2024-07-29 15:37:30
74阅读
删除视图的sql语句是“DROP VIEW”,具体格式为“DROP VIEW [ , …]”。“DROP VIEW”语句可以一次删除多个视图,但是必须在每个视图上拥有DROP权限。本教程操作环境:windows7系统、mysql8版本、Dell G3电脑。删除视图是指删除 MySQL 数据库中已存在的视图。删除视图时,只能删除视图的定义,不会删除数据。可以使用 DROP VIEW 语句来删除视图。
转载
2023-06-02 11:11:35
303阅读
我们先用下面的DDL和DML创建名为hrs的数据库并为其二维表添加如下所示的数据,再通过创建的hrs数据库对视图、函数和过程进行介绍-- 创建名为hrs的数据库并指定默认的字符集
create database `hrs` default charset utf8mb4;
-- 切换到hrs数据库
use `hrs`;
-- 创建部⻔表
转载
2024-08-09 14:19:03
0阅读
查看数据库里有哪些表:创建表的形式:C...
原创
2023-05-05 17:26:33
89阅读